## Leverage Senior Discounts – Your Secret Weapon

One of the biggest perks of reaching a certain age? Senior discounts! Airlines, hotels, tour companies, museums, and even restaurants often offer reduced rates for seniors. Don’t be shy about asking – you’d be surprised how much you can save. Websites like AARP and The Senior List are treasure troves of discounts and deals specifically for seniors.

## Embrace Off-Season Travel – Escape the Crowds and High Prices

Think back to your school days – remember how much quieter (and cheaper!) things were when everyone else was in class? The same principle applies to travel. Shoulder seasons (spring and fall) and even the off-season often offer fantastic deals on flights and accommodation. Plus, you’ll enjoy a more tranquil experience with fewer crowds.

## Be Accommodation Savvy – Explore Budget-Friendly Options

Hotels are comfortable, but they can eat into your budget quickly. Consider alternatives like cozy bed and breakfasts, home rentals (think Airbnb or VRBO), or even hostels with private rooms. These options often provide unique experiences and a chance to connect with locals or fellow travelers.

## Pack Light – Avoid those Pesky Airline Fees

Remember those extra baggage fees? Those can really add up. Packing light not only saves you money but also makes traveling a breeze. Invest in a good quality, lightweight suitcase and pack versatile clothing items that can be mixed and matched.

## Embrace Free Activities – Discover Hidden Gems and Local Experiences

Some of the best travel experiences are absolutely free! Explore local markets, wander through parks, visit free museums, or take advantage of free walking tours. These activities immerse you in the local culture and provide a richer understanding of your destination.

## Consider a Travel Agent – Expertise Can Save You Money

Yes, travel agents still exist! And they can be especially helpful for seniors looking for the best deals and hassle-free planning. A good travel agent knows the ins and outs of finding discounts, navigating complicated itineraries, and can often secure special rates you wouldn’t find on your own.

## Travel Slow – Savor Each Moment and Your Budget

Instead of rushing from one city to the next, consider slow travel. Spend more time in fewer places, really immersing yourself in the local culture and taking advantage of all that each destination has to offer. Slow travel not only reduces transportation costs but allows for a more relaxed and enjoyable trip.
